Space Orphan

Shut up About The Sun

2016-11-28

Loved this album. Pretty similar to the likes of Lettuce, or Galactic. It posses that funk sound i like to hear when i listen to those other bands, with of course a little different spin on it from Space Orphan. There are a couple tracks which sounded like covers, but just couldn't place them. I wished it was longer, since it was only 7 tracks, but my son was jamming and bobbing his head to it after the second song. Favorite tracks were 2, 4, and 5. Very solid, loved it and will add it to the collection for sure.
